Product Description
IC697MEM715 is a CMOS expansion memory manufactured by GE Automation and Controls. IC697MEM715 is available in different versions: 64 KB, 128 KB, 256 KB, and 512 KB. Typically these memories are used to expand the data and logic memory in CPU 772/771 modules or in the programmable co-processor module (alternatively known as IC697PCM711). IC697MEM715 is configurable for both data and program storage.
IC697MEM715 is configured as a daughter board and is placed in the same slot as the module in which it operates. Memory of the base board and the daughter board are supplementary. In the event of power loss, memory is retained by the battery on the base board housing. Logic program memory is repeatedly error-checked by the PLC CPU as a background task by way of checksum routine. When power is cycled and during hard or soft resets, the PCM error automatically checks storage memory. IC697MEM715 does not require an additional slot for configuration, and it is adjustable for storage of the program and data.
IC697MEM715 uses MS-DOS or Windows programming as software for configuration. IC697MEM715 includes a lithium battery, which manages a calendar clock. In case of power failure, the lithium battery also retains the user memory. Battery shelf life is 10 years with an operating temperature of 20 0C or 68 0F. The ideal memory retention capacity of the battery is six months. Removal of the old battery should not occur unless installation of the new battery is complete. IC697MEM715 requires no tools required for installation and is field installable.
